Dichloridobis[N-(diphenylphosphino)isopropylamine-[kappa]P]platinum(II) chloroform solvate

G. M. Brown, M. R. J. Elsegood, J. R. Evans, N. M. Sanchez Ballester, M. B. Smith and K. Blann

Abstract: The cis isomer of the square-planar title complex has been crystallized as the chloroform solvate, [PtCl2(C15H18NP)2]·CHCl3. Comparison of the Pt-P and Pt-Cl bond lengths and the Cl-Pt-Cl and P-Pt-P angles with the known compounds cis-{Ph2PN(H)R'}2PtCl2 reveals that the R' substituents have negligible effects on these structural parameters. Intramolecular N-H...Cl and intermolecular Pt-Cl...H-CCl3 hydrogen bonds are evident in the title structure.
